The Manufactured Body Exhibition 2023 and 2024 Research Archive.
This five-room exhibition, a solo show, was installed and transformed a disused 15th-century building, The Ancient Priors. The exhibition was fully funded by the UK government's Levelling Up Funds, through Crawley Borough Council in association with Word Festival 2023. The exhibition launched the Crawleys Cultural Quarter programme and was submitted as my graduation exhibition/ final work towards my BA (Hons) in Fine Art.
Curated around my personal story, the exhibition questions how we have manufactured our bodies.
The exhibition features a diverse range of works, including drawings, paintings, photographs, body prints, installations, workshops, performance art, and documentation. It invited everyone to participate in self-acceptance and self-empowerment, exploring how society shapes our bodies and aims to inform the audience about the effects of societal views on body image. The exhibition encourages us to acknowledge the realities of our bodies, such as cellulite and loose skin, and challenges the stigma surrounding body size and measurements.
It asks questions about what our future bodies will look like and the affects of current social standards, politics, medicine, environmental impact, social media, and beauty standards, especially in relation to body weight.
2024
The 2024 Manufactured Body Research Archive, which was part of the MFA Archive at the Royal College of Art, presented my research in postcard format. It highlights the research involved in creating the final visual and written work.
